Arte y política

Arte y política2019

Elisa Pérez Buchelli

About this book

The author deals with the diversity that existed in the arts of action in the Latin American cultural and intellectual context in the mid-twentieth century through the trajectory of three Uruguayan female artists: Teresa Vila, Graciela Figueroa (ballet dancer, director and choreographer) and Teresa Trujillo (visual artist, dancer and choreographer), where the importance of the body, the taking of public spaces and the various ways of articulating artistic experimentation and forms of intervention in the political sphere constituted powerful forms of political intervention in the Latin America of the 1960's and 1970's with global projection.
